Output d81b78cf36ae90aa3084d7b10968f79baaac68524ed15fbc8c567a8b2861b1d6:0

value
2676181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b3e854c73b6106ec9814da57327216e78488bd7 OP_EQUAL
address
3BU585pKX9jzuuDHPhcuNpru5JyVEBvBoJ
transaction
d81b78cf36ae90aa3084d7b10968f79baaac68524ed15fbc8c567a8b2861b1d6
spent
true